Differential effects of aging on neuroendocrine responses to physostigmine in normal men.

Abstract

We assessed the effects of age on cholinergic regulation of the hypothalamic-pituitary-adrenal axis and other neuroendocrine systems by measuring the plasma cortisol and beta-endorphin responses to an infusion of the centrally active cholinesterase inhibitor physostigmine (0.0125 mg/kg) in 12 healthy older men (68 +/- 1.7 yr) and 9 healthy young men (25 +/- 1.4 yr). We also measured the responses to physostigmine of plasma GH, arginine vasopressin, epinephrine, and norepinephrine (NE). As estimated by comparing calculated areas under the curve, older subjects had greater cortisol (P = 0.02) and beta-endorphin (P less than 0.01) secretory responses, but a reduced GH (P less than 0.01) secretory response. The arginine vasopressin response did not differ between groups. By analysis of variance, older subjects also had a greater epinephrine response (P = 0.01). Older subjects had higher basal NE concentrations (P less than 0.05), but NE responses to physostigmine did not differ between groups. These findings suggest age-related enhancement of the cholinergic stimulatory regulation of the hypothalamic-pituitary-adrenal axis and adrenal medulla. They also confirm previous reports of reduced GH secretory response with aging in normal men.

摘要

我们通过测量12名健康老年男性(68±1.7岁)和9名健康青年男性(25±1.4岁)静脉输注中枢活性胆碱酯酶抑制剂毒扁豆碱(0.0125mg/kg)后血浆皮质醇和β-内啡肽的反应,评估年龄对下丘脑-垂体-肾上腺轴及其他神经内分泌系统胆碱能调节的影响。我们还测量了血浆生长激素(GH)、精氨酸加压素、肾上腺素和去甲肾上腺素(NE)对毒扁豆碱的反应。通过比较计算曲线下面积估计,老年受试者有更大的皮质醇(P = 0.02)和β-内啡肽(P<0.01)分泌反应,但GH分泌反应降低(P<0.01)。两组间精氨酸加压素反应无差异。通过方差分析,老年受试者肾上腺素反应也更大(P = 0.01)。老年受试者基础NE浓度更高(P<0.05),但两组间毒扁豆碱诱导的NE反应无差异。这些发现提示,下丘脑-垂体-肾上腺轴和肾上腺髓质的胆碱能刺激调节存在与年龄相关的增强。它们也证实了既往关于正常男性GH分泌反应随年龄增长而降低的报道。
